    Originally posted by boostedese View Post
    It doesn't rub at all. Running -3 camber up front and can turn the wheels full lock with no contact. Front fenders are rolled but not pulled. Hope that helps.
    When tony had these made and on his car for some reason the rear didnt look like it poked as much as yours does. Are you running spacers in the rear? any camber in the rear?
